Moped man fatally struck by hit-and-run driver in FairhavenĀ 

FAIRHAVEN, MA ā€“ A 29-year-old man was transported to St. Lukeā€™s Hospital, where he passed away after getting struck by a hit-and-run driver while on a moped scooter Saturday.Ā 

This collision happened around 7:15 p.m. on Main Street, according to Turnto10.Ā 

Police had identified the man as Alexis Alvarez, stating he was riding his scooter near the Riverside Cemetery when he was struck by the driver (who fled the scene afterward), operating a Chevy Silverado pickup truck.Ā 

Officers also have reason to believe another suspect struck Alvarez but did not extend commentary regarding this second person and their automobile, although they did say no arrests were pursued at this time.Ā 

In addition, police have not yet apprehended the suspect, nor have they provided additional details concerning this deadly wreck.
